sql问题

假如我有个color字段,里边存有 black,white,yellow,blue等,我想通过写sql实现参数面板的复选框功能,写的   select *from 表  where  color in (‘${cc}’);

之后再在参数面板将cc添加进去,但是最后查不出数据

FineReport 一行 发布于 2021-6-23 23:36
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共2回答
最佳回答
1
zsh331Lv8专家互助
发布于2021-6-24 00:09

场景二有详解--数据集参数的多值查询-https://help.fanruan.com/finereport/doc-view-1287.html

————————————

select * from 表  where  color in ('${cc}')

控件值分隔符   ','

-- SQL语句及参数控件分隔符,注意输入法状态,用「英文状态」输入;

————————————

image.png

最佳回答
0
用户Anrdn3533Lv5初级互助
发布于2021-6-23 23:43
看一下复选框的设置
  • 一行 一行(提问者) 感谢,是复选框的返回值没设置好
    2021-06-24 00:40 
  • 2关注人数
  • 375浏览人数
  • 最后回答于:2021-6-24 00:09
    请选择关闭问题的原因
    确定 取消
    返回顶部